Job Title:Waiting Staff – weddings/events
Location: Aldsworth
Start Date:first date sat 21st June 12-6pm
Positions Available: 3 temp Workers to do shifts over the summer
Job Description:
We are currently seeking three reliable members of Waiting staff for assignments based in Aldsworth involving weddings and events. The role involves Serving and clearing food to the wedding party and general set up/ clear down tasks.
Key Responsibilities:
Help serving food, clearing tables ect
Assisting with site setup and clearing
Unloading and organising deliveries
General site support as required
Requirements:
Full UK driving licence preferred (not essential)
previous front og house experience
Ability to follow instructions and work as part of a team
Reliability and punctuality
